  5. South Florida Water Management District -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/South_Florida_Water...

    The South Florida Water Management District (SFWMD) is a regional governmental district that oversees water resources from Orlando to the Florida Keys.The mission of the SFWMD is to manage and protect water resources by balancing and improving water quality, flood control, natural systems, and water supply, covering 16 counties in Central and Southern Florida.

  8. C-44 Reservoir and Stormwater Treatment Area -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/C-44_Reservoir_and_Storm...

    The C-44 Reservoir and Stormwater Treatment Area is the first component of the Indian River Lagoon-South (IRL-S) project, part of the Comprehensive Everglades Restoration Plan (CERP), a joint effort between the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ers Jacksonville District and the local sponsor, the South Florida Water Management District.
